The TieBot is a creation inspired by an illustration I found online called the "Tie Fighter" from an artist named Jake Parker. The illustration that inspired this imagined the tie fighter as a mech that was a samurai warrior, Loving mechs and robots, I decided to create my own variant of this idea.

The TieBot, is a fully articulated mech fully 3d printed and is custom modeled. The TieBot can be posed in almost any way, his arms are jointed and swiveled designed with many different joint types. There are ratcheting joints in the shoulders and hip, mushroom joints and barrel joints in the arms and legs along with a 4 way pin joint in the ankles. Everything on this mech moves right down to the fingers.


The TieBot was built to scale with the vintage sized 3.75 inch figures and has a fully detailed interior and opening cockpit. 

The Alien Queen 

This was one of my first multi part builds with my 3d printer years ago. Many of the parts were kit bashed from other models or downloaded and re-meshed. The alien queen was built to be a scene representing her smashing thru a wall to get her target. The orange beacon is a small rotating led that gives a really good feel of the movie, I then added the small led spot lights just to make the queen pop.
